HP 已按计划在九月底发布了webOS开源后的第一个版本Open webOS,不过程序框架Enyo的发布却姗姗来迟。此前公布的计划是于四月发布Enyo2.1程序框架,不过直到10月底才刚刚发布(掐指一算,要是 10月还不发布,那恐怕就要等到下一个4月了)。自今年1月Enyo2.0 Beta发布后,该程序框架一直在更新,不过从2.0到2.1,实在是等的太久;其中难免有重建开发团队核心成员的因素,而这足以让任何项目停滞几个月, 所以晚了这几个月确实情有可原。
刚刚发布的Enyo2.1包含了一些会让跨平台程序开发者很感兴趣的新特性。有基于LESS的主题支持,可以使开发者更加灵活地自定义已发布的Onyx用户 界面小工具。而TouchPad上的多国支持文库-g11n-也随着Enyo2.1被公布出来,使得日期、时间和数字的格式可以和基于Enyo2.0框架 开发的程序中所使用的语言区域设置向匹配。
另外,Enyo不仅仅是webOS上的程序框架,同时还是支持桌面端浏览器的开源框架。
Enyo小组还把安卓和iOS上的Chrome列入开发支持的第一序列,这就意味着小组会最先解决这两个平台的漏洞修复、特性修正,和一些其他测试。他们也会将IE10(包括Windows 8的触控指令)和Kindle Fire支持添加到Enyo2.1的支持列表中。
最 近,Enyo2.1还包含了一些新的用户界面插件,使得搭建应用更加容易。Onyx现在有了新的范围控制滑块和时间日期选取工具。控制布局的库中也添加了 名为ImageView的工具,它支持多点触控缩放平移。Enyo Sampler中也加入了这些新工具的实例,所以你在自己的新应用中添加这些特性之前,可以好好体验一下,看看它们表现如何。
截至目前,open webOS团队以及相关的小组基本已经恢复到之前的状态,剩下的就是按部就班的开发和推进了。Enyo 2.0,再见。Enyo 2.1,你好。